The MacBook Air 13” is designed to be unbelievably thin and light, measuring only 1.7cm at its deepest and weighing less than 1.4kg. But it is also designed to be powerful, capable, durable and enjoyable to use. Powerful components give you smoother graphics, faster storage and all-round serious performance but with enough battery life to get you through the day. Made from lightweight aluminium, MacBook Air features a unibody design for both the main enclosure and the display, giving a higher-precision, less complex design with fewer parts. That translates to a notebook that’s exceptionally thin and light, yet durable enough to handle the rigours of everyday use. In addition, MacBook Air offers innovations you won’t find anywhere else — like the MagSafe 2 power connector, which breaks cleanly away from the notebook if you accidentally trip over the power lead. MacBook Air also features a whole host of great connectivity options, including USB 3.0, an SDXC card slot and a lighting fast Thunderbolt 2 port.

Millions of pixels but millimetres thin, the MacBook Air display is both an engineering feat and a design breakthrough. The display measures only 4.86mm thin but the resolution makes it feel like you are looking at a much larger screen. With a resolution of 1440 x 900 and LED backlighting making colours bright and vibrant, whether you are editing photos, perfecting a presentation or watching your favourite movie, you’re going to love what you see on the MacBook Air 13”
The fifth generation Intel Core i5 processor will handle whatever you throw at it, allowing you to multi-task and work on intensive applications without experiencing any lag. Applications run faster and more efficiently than before. So everything you normally do on a computer you can do even quicker. Send email, write reports, create presentations, touch up photos, edit home movies and all the little (and big) tasks in between. The i5 uses the Intel HD Graphics 6000 GPU to ensure visuals are smooth whether you’re playing a game, watching a video or editing a photo.

A comfortable, full-size keyboard is essential for a great notebook experience, and the one that is featured in the MacBook Air is just as comfortable to type on as a desktop keyboard. LED-backlighting allows you to type in low-light conditions and built-in sensors detect changes in the ambient lighting adjusting both the keyboard and display brightness automatically.
Multi-Touch technology is part of practically every Apple product. It’s the best and most personal way to interact with your devices. And the optimal way to experience Multi-Touch on a notebook is through a trackpad. That’s precisely the case with MacBook Air. The trackpad’s spacious, all-glass surface doesn’t have a button because the whole thing is the button. And with Multi-Touch gestures in OS X, you can interact with MacBook Air in ways that feel more intuitive and realistic than ever before.
MacBook Air 13” features a large 54-watt-hour lithium-polymer battery that works with the power-efficient fifth generation Intel Core processor to last all day. You can expect up to 12 hours of battery life on a single charge whether you are surfing the web or watching films. MacBook Air will also preserve its own battery life by entering standby mode after it’s been asleep for more than three hours, helping to conserve battery life for up to 30 days. You can even continue to receive new emails and calendar invitations while your MacBook’s asleep by enabling Power Nap.
MacBook Air supports 802.11ac Wi-Fi so you’ll be able to connect to an 802.11ac router and experience wireless performance that’s up to 3 times faster than previous generations. Bluetooth 4.0 will allow you to connect to Bluetooth enabled devices like speakers, headphones and other computers to stream and share files without wires.
Two USB 3.0 ports will allow you to connect peripheral items such as mice, printers or USB storage devices, and transfer data 10 times faster than USB 2.0 with compatible devices. The Thunderbolt 2 port allows rapid transferring of files, so you’ll save time when trying to save large files in a hurry, delivering transfer speeds of up to 20 Gbps.
The widescreen 720p FaceTime HD camera will let your friends and family see more of you in video calls and ensure that everyone can fit into a picture without having to crowd around the display. The dual microphones are great when you want to be heard, reducing background noise from behind the notebook, so your speech will be as clear as your face.
